Specification Comparison
| Parameter | UCC28782CDRTWRSource | UCC28782BDLRTWR | UCC28782ADRTWR |
|---|---|---|---|
| Manufacturer | Texas Instruments | Texas Instruments | Texas Instruments |
| Package Type | Quad Flat No-Lead | Quad Flat No-Lead | Quad Flat No-Lead |
| Pin Count | 25 | 25 | 25 |
| Temperature Range | -40.0°C ~ 125.0°C | -40.0°C ~ 125.0°C | -40.0°C ~ 125.0°C |
| Price | — | $1.1300 | $1.9900 |
| Electrical Parameters | |||
| Pbfree Code | Yes | Yes | Yes |
| YTEOL | 15 | 15 | 15 |
| Analog IC - Other Type | SWITCHING CONTROLLER | SWITCHING CONTROLLER | SWITCHING CONTROLLER |
| Control Mode | CURRENT-MODE | CURRENT-MODE | CURRENT-MODE |
| Control Technique | PULSE WIDTH MODULATION | PULSE WIDTH MODULATION | PULSE WIDTH MODULATION |
| Input Voltage-Max | 34 V | 34 V | 34 V |
| Input Voltage-Min | 14 V | 14 V | 14 V |
| Input Voltage-Nom | 20 V | 20 V | 20 V |
| JESD-30 Code | S-PQCC-N24 | S-PQCC-N24 | S-PQCC-N24 |
| JESD-609 Code | e4 | e4 | e4 |
| Number of Functions | 1 | 1 | 1 |
| Output Current-Max | 0.4525 A | 0.4525 A | 0.4525 A |
| Package Body Material |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Y |
| Package Equivalence Code | LCC24,.16SQ,20 | LCC24,.16SQ,20 | LCC24,.16SQ,20 |
| Package Shape | SQUARE | SQUARE | SQUARE |
| Package Style |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E |
| Peak Reflow Temperature (Cel) | 260 | 260 | 260 |
| Supply Current-Max (Isup) | 3.55 mA | 3.55 mA | 3.55 mA |
| Supply Voltage-Nom (Vsup) | 20 V | 20 V | — |
| Surface Mount | YES | YES | YES |
| Switcher Configuration | BUCK-BOOST | BUCK-BOOST | BUCK-BOOST |
| Switching Frequency-Max | 1500 kHz | 1500 kHz | 1500 kHz |
| Terminal Finish | Nickel/Palladium/Gold (Ni/Pd/Au) | Nickel/Palladium/Gold (Ni/Pd/Au) | Nickel/Palladium/Gold (Ni/Pd/Au) |
| Terminal Form | NO LEAD | NO LEAD | NO LEAD |
| Terminal Pitch | 0.5 mm | 0.5 mm | 0.5 mm |
| Terminal Position | QUAD | QUAD | QUAD |
| Time@Peak Reflow Temperature-Max (s) | 30 | 30 | 30 |
Cells highlighted in yellow indicate differing values across parts. Always verify with official datasheets before substitution.
